What Type Of Property Should You Buy In Australia: Houses vs. Townhouses vs. Apartments?

According to the Australian Bureau of Statistics, over the last 12 months, property prices have grown by 16.8%. With the rise of property prices, the choice of the right property also becomes a little more crucial and difficult. Hence, before finding the right property for your investment, it’s important to explore the different types of properties.

Properties In Australia

Whether it is your first time buying property in Australia or you are a seasoned real estate investor, it is crucial to do your research. For first-time buyers, you should have the objectives and priorities clear. 

The types of property in Australia can be mainly divided into houses, apartments, and townhouses.

Houses

Houses are the traditional and most popular stand-alone dwelling in Australia. When you buy residential homes, you are purchasing the land on an individual title.

In 2016, about 72.9% of the population was living in houses. Houses provide a lot of flexibility and privacy, but it comes with their drawbacks too.

Benefits Of Houses

A house offers you a large amount of space along with privacy, flexibility, and customization options for your property. It is a great option for people having large families and a big budget.

1. More Space

Houses generally offer a lot of space compared to apartments or townhouses due to the minimum block sizes set by the government.

2. Outdoor Space

Most houses have a front or back garden/ backyard, which is not the case with apartments or townhouses. The outdoor space can have multiple uses like gardening, entertainment, relaxation, etc. The kids can roam around, and you can even install a pool if you want.

3. Privacy

You get more privacy with houses, as you are not sharing common areas or living close to your neighbors. As a result, you do not get disturbed by your neighbors and live in peace as well.

4. Flexibility

Being the sole owner of the title brings a lot of flexibility and freedom. You do not have to abide by the bylaws that generally townhouse and apartment owners follow.

5. Better Resale Value

The resale value of houses generally appreciates more than those of townhouses or apartments. Lenders also easily lend you more money when purchasing a home.

Drawbacks Of Houses

The houses can be pretty expensive both in terms of the upfront cost of buying and maintenance costs. There should be enough capital for not only buying but also maintaining the property.

1. High Price

Houses are generally more expensive than apartments or townhouses due to the more space they provide. It can be an entry barrier for some buyers.

2. Excessive Maintenance

A house is so spacious and having lots of amenities requires constant maintenance. You would have to maintain the gardens, sewage, drainage, cleaning, and many more. You can do it yourself if you wish or hire professionals that will add to the cost.

3. Costlier Bills

Houses being larger require more resources, whether it is for maintaining temperature or general plumbing. It results in higher utility bills overall as compared to apartments or townhouses.

Townhouses

A townhouse is similar to a house. It is a multi-level building that offers space and privacy as well. They also often have front and backyard just like houses but usually smaller.

It differs from houses in terms of ownership. Unlike home ownership, in townhouse ownership, you only own a strata title and share a particular land with others.

Benefits Of Townhouses

Townhouses offer you more space for your money than apartments, and they are cheaper than a house. It is a middle ground between affordability and space. A family can opt for the townhouse if on a budget.

1. Space

Townhouses have more space than an apartment due to being two or three stories. The space provided is in between houses and apartments. It can be suitable for people who want a larger area at an affordable price.

2. Privacy 

Townhouses are designed similarly to a house to provide privacy to their residents. They do not have any shared areas, and there exists just one common wall. 

3. Flexibility & Freedom

Unlike houses, you have some restrictions in townhouses. There are bylaws in place, but those bylaws are mostly more relaxed than the bylaws of apartment complexes.

4. Price 

Townhouses are more affordable than houses. Buying a house in a competitive locality can cost a lot more than a townhouse.

Drawbacks Of Townhouses

Unlike houses, you would not get as much space and customization options in townhouses. You have to share the land with other owners and follow the bylaws as well. 

1. Space

A townhouse offers less space than a house. If you have a large family, then it may not be the right choice for you.

2. Price

If you are on a budget, the townhouse is not the most affordable option. It is more expensive than an apartment. On top of which you also have to pay maintenance expenses and upkeep fees for common areas.

3. Uniform Structure With Customizations

Townhouses are often constructed with the same layout and design as the other buildings in an area. This may make people feel that their houses lack individuality. Although you can customize your interiors, it isn’t as customizable as a house.

4. Privacy

You would have less privacy in a townhouse when compared to a house because you are sharing the same land with other owners. 

5. Resale value 

The resale value of townhouses is usually less appreciated than a house. So a townhouse may not be as good as a house for investment.

Apartments

An apartment is a smaller accommodation as compared to a townhouse. When you buy an apartment, you share the ownership with the different owners. Generally, there will be a body corporate as well that will make the bylaws. 

Benefits Of Apartments

The major benefit of apartments is that it is very affordable. An apartment would be an ideal choice for single people. An apartment also has fewer maintenance fees as compared to houses or townhouses. You also get enhanced security and various common amenities like a swimming pool, garden, etc. 

1. Affordable Purchase Price

Apartments are generally more affordable than townhouses or houses. This makes them a good option for buyers on a budget. Plus, you get a lot of choices due to new apartments being built in cities like Brisbane, Sydney, and Melbourne.

2. Less Maintenance

Apartments being small in size do not require much cleaning when compared to a house. The maintenance body also charges fewer fees, and you don’t have to maintain common areas like gardens, lawns, gutters, etc.

3. Security

Modern Apartments generally offer better security. The buildings have guards, swipe cards, and CCTV systems to enhance the safety and security of the building.

4. Small Bills

Your utility bills like electricity and gas will be less compared to houses because the apartments are small. They don’t need many resources to function.

5. Amenities

With apartments, you enjoy facilities and amenities such as lifts, swimming pools, gyms, gardens, tennis courts, playground, basketball court, etc., depending on the builder.

6. Location

Most apartments are usually constructed in or near city centers. This saves time to reach day-to-day places such as supermarkets/ malls, schools, churches, business establishments, hospitals, etc. 

Drawbacks Of Apartments

The major drawback of apartments is the less space you get to live in when compared to houses or townhouses. The maintenance fees can also be higher in some places than townhouses if the apartment body provides a lot of amenities and charges for it.

1. Less Space

The major drawback of apartments is that they’re small in area compared to both houses and townhouses. It wouldn’t be suitable for people who need large space.

2. Maintenance Fees

These are generally much cheaper than houses or townhouses. But if your apartment has a lot of amenities and facilities, the fee can be comparable to townhouses.

3. Customizability & Flexibility

Apartments usually have bylaws and rules related to pets, renovation expenses, noise levels, etc. This limits the customization you can do in your house, and the rules also bind you.

4. Limited parking spaces

Apartments being small in size, have more residents in a single building. But the parking space is limited, and you may even be asked to pay extra for that.

Key Takeaways

The choice depends on what your needs are. Do you have a big family? How’s your financial condition? Are you buying property to build a property portfolio or living basis?

You can make a wise decision after considering these factors. The house offers you the most space with a townhouse and apartments following it. 

Similar is the trend for affordability, apartments being the most affordable. For accessibility to the city, apartments can be a suitable option as they’re generally closer to cities. And if you want to customize your place, a house is the way to go. Research-based property investment will help you make the best decision.
